The "legs" of a table or a chair (in Creole)? That would be "pye"? How would you say "That chair has a broken leg, don't sit on it."

the leg of a chair → pye chèz la
the leg of a table → pye tab la
the legs of bed → pye kabann nan

That chair has a broken leg.  Don't sit on it.
Pye chèz sa kase.  Pa chita sou li.
